## v2.8.0 — Setting renamed

Feedcheck's podcast validator no longer reads PODVAL_TOKEN. The setting is now FEEDCHECK_API_TOKEN to match the other service prefixes. The old name is ignored as of this release, so validation jobs will fail auth until the env file is updated. Remove the stale entry, then add the new line directly below this note:

sealed setting: ARCHIVE_KEY3=8d0

**CI flake — EchoHall audio-guide app.** Heads up for security review: the signing step in our CI keeps failing intermittently on the arm64 runners, and the workaround someone added retries with verification disabled. Not great. I've re-enabled strict verification and pinned the toolchain, so expect slightly slower builds until the runner image is rebuilt. To confirm you're reviewing the patched pipeline, check the trace token below.

session token of yajof-bagef = htk4_937d

**Q3 Planning Note – Sales Leads**

The Branton Row office will close at the end of Q3. Accounts currently served from Branton Row move to the Caldmere team; handover lists go out next week. No changes to territories otherwise. Travel budgets will be adjusted accordingly. Questions go to Sorrel Haines. The reasoning behind the closure is summarised below.

internal memo for taguf-kafop: Novmirax Group plans to lower the Oliius list price by 42.0 percent in March. The board signed off on a budget of $367.8 million for Project Belael. The renewal with Drumirax Logistics closes at $302.4 million a year, 54.0 percent below the last contract. Project Kelys slips by a full year because of the staffing delay.